Chemist Postdoctoral Fellow - 75310
Organization: CH-Chemical Sciences
A position for a Postdoctoral Fellow is available in the Atomic, Molecular, and Optical theory group at Lawrence Berkeley National Laboratory, within the project “Simulating the generation, evolution and fate of electronic excitations in molecular and nanoscale materials with first principles methods” that has been funded through the Scientific Discovery through Advanced Computing (SciDAC) program of the Department of Energy.
Responsibilities:
The appointment will entail the implementation and use of a combined grid and Gaussian basis electronic structure method to study metastable electronic states.
